Building a Robust 2x4 Coffee Table

A coffee table is a cornerstone of any living room, and building your own with 2x4s is surprisingly straightforward. This project emphasizes clean lines and a minimalist aesthetic. We'll use simple butt joints and wood glue for strong, reliable connections. No complicated joinery techniques are required, making it perfect for DIY enthusiasts of all skill levels. The finished table will boast a spacious top, perfect for placing drinks, books, or remotes.

Materials Needed:

  • Four 2x4s (8 feet long) for the legs
  • Two 2x4s (4 feet long) for the long sides of the frame
  • Two 2x4s (3 feet long) for the short sides of the frame
  • One large sheet of plywood or reclaimed wood for the tabletop
  • Wood glue
  • Wood screws (3-inch)
  • Sandpaper
  • Wood stain or paint (optional)
  • Construction Steps:

    Begin by cutting the 2x4s to the specified lengths. Next, assemble the frame by joining the 2x4s using wood glue and screws, creating a sturdy rectangular base. Attach the legs to the corners of the frame, ensuring they are perfectly square. Finally, secure the tabletop to the frame using screws. Finish by sanding and applying your chosen stain or paint for a personalized touch.

    Constructing a Sturdy 2x4 Bench

    A 2x4 bench offers both practicality and aesthetic appeal. Perfect for entryways, bedrooms, or even outdoor spaces, this project showcases the strength and durability of 2x4 construction. We'll leverage simple techniques, resulting in a remarkably robust piece of furniture that can comfortably withstand daily use. The design emphasizes clean lines and allows for customization based on your desired length and height.

    Materials Needed:

    • Several 2x4s (length depends on desired bench size)
    • Plywood or planks for the seat
    • Wood screws
    • Wood glue
    • Sandpaper
    • Exterior-grade paint or stain (for outdoor use)

    Construction Steps:

    Start by cutting the 2x4s to create the legs and supports for the bench's frame. Assemble the frame, ensuring that the legs are securely fastened to the supports with both glue and screws. Then, attach the plywood or planks to form the seat. Sand the entire bench thoroughly and apply paint or stain to complete the project. For outdoor use, ensure you use weather-resistant materials and sealants.
